Frequently Asked Questions about Vero Beach
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Vero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Vero Beach ranges from $1,500 to $2,879 with an average monthly rent of $2,067.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Vero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Vero Beach range from $1,174 to $5,899.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,533.
How expensive are Vero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 20 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Vero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,361 to $6,209 - averaging $2,997 for the location.
